Abstract
The authors propose a QoS (quality of service) framework which strikes a balance between the quality criteria of the service providers and the quality requirement of the users. QoS is classified in terms of performance, resource, and priority constraints. The authors discuss how this framework fits into a connection-oriented fast packet environment. They also show how QoS negotiation is conducted in such a network, so that the QoS of the available network resources matches that needed by the users
